Payment Assistance (based on Facility)Many substance abuse rehabilitation programs in the United States provide payment assistance to men and women having difficulties with drug or alcohol addiction and want to get help. The person in need of treatment can choose a rehabilitation facility which is a good fit, meaning the treatment curriculum and design of the program would provide them the best results. The addicted individual can then seek advice from one of the treatment professionals at the drug or alcohol rehabilitation program to talk about what kind of payment assistance options are available or that they qualify for. The financial department in most drug and alcohol rehabilitation centers are more than willing to work with potential clients to get them started by offering payment assistance, and if this is unavailable, treatment professionals will typically work with the person to locate an equivalent or comparable treatment facility which is more affordable or that can provide workable financing options so that they can get the help they so desperately need.
